Since late last year I have been the owner of minisprint mk 2 5835.
Yesterday was only the second time I've had a chance to try it and I'm looking for advice in how to sit in it! It might sound daft but my club - Otley S.C. - needs many quick changes of direction and I'm not finding it easy even though the bar behind the seat has been removed - it seems the mainsheet used to be attached to it but it got in the way.
I have read that this version is better suited to more open water but I would like to persevere a bit longer.

I have a Sprint mk2, I sail on a small lake and have no difficulty with multiple fast tacks, to the extent that people shout propelling.
The trick is to always lift your front leg back over plank, so both legs will be aft, I then kneel in centre of boat until boom passes over, resit put leg over plank and resume sailing.
